Hello. I thought something like this would be fun, so why not. Please note that this will only work on unmodded Switches, since this will use NSO. The tournament will be hosted in an arena, with the 2 players and atleast one person watching it.
Rules: 1v1, 3 Stocks, 7 Minutes, Best of 3, Items Off, Stage Hazards Off, FS Meter Off
Stages: Battlefield, Small Battlefield, Final Destination, Dream Land, Yoshi's Story, Fountain of Dreams, Pokémon Stadium, WarioWare Inc., Yoshi's Island, Lylat Cruise, Pokémon Stadium 2, Smashville, Pictochat 2, Kalos Pokémon League, Town and City, Wily Castle, and Midgar

I'm seeking at the very least 8 players (I'm already one, so seven I guess.). If more than 8 join, the tournament will expand to 16 players or more.
Dates/Time for matches will be decided once everyone joins, then sent to both players. If for one reason or another, one or more players cannot play in that specific time, the match will be delayed, and the other matches will go on. If, incredibly, every single player is available at the same time to join the arena, the tournament will be played in one go. Who goes VS who is selected randomly. More info might be posted later.

To sign up, just reply to this thread and say something among the lines of "I'm in.". Players of all skill levels can join.
